Testing of Autonomous Underwater Vehicle
Wednesday, January 16, 2019, Singapore
From 21 January to 28 February, testing of an Autonomous Underwater Vehicle (AUV) will be carried out north of Small Craft Anchorage ‘A’.
According to the Maritime and Port Authority of Singapore Port Marine Notice No.007 of 2019, the testing will be conducted between 0800 and 1800 hours daily within the working area bounded by the following co-ordinates (WGS 84 Datum):
1) 01 deg. 18.480’N / 103 deg. 58.103’E
2) 01 deg. 18.566’N / 103 deg. 58.470’E
3) 01 deg. 18.400’N / 103 deg. 58.518’E
4) 01 deg. 18.313’N / 103 deg. 58.150’E
OPL 22 will deploy and recover the AUV by crane. A safety boat will be in attendance at all times to warn and re-direct craft in the vicinity to keep clear of the working area.
The craft will exhibit the appropriate local and international day signals.
When in the vicinity of the working area, mariners are reminded to:
a) Keep well clear and not to enter the working area;
b) Maintain a proper lookout;
c) Proceed at a safe speed and navigate with caution;
d) Maintain a listening watch on VHF Channel 12 (East Control);
and
e) Communicate with East Control on VHF Channel 12 for assistance, if required.
